Here's photos of what my system looked like at the initial build in Feb 2013. 2 tanks (1 fish tank & 1 sump tank) 2 growbeds (1 hydroton flood & drain and 1 floating growbed) Harbour Freight 1350gph pump

Current system has 4 tanks (3 fish tanks & 1 sump) 4 growbeds (1 hydroton flood & drain and 3 floating growbeds) 2 dutch buckets 2 5" long NFT with strawberries Swirl Filter and Pad Filter All still runs on the 1350 gph pump Added air stones to all the fish tanks
